Bess of Hardwick, also known as Elizabeth Talbot, Countess of Shrewsbury (c. 1527-1608), was the fourth daughter of a relatively minor gentry family who rose to the highest levels of English nobility through four advantageous marriages to become one of the richest women in English history.
